(8/9/99, 4 p.m. PDT) - Portraying the role of a street hustler on film doesn't bother Ice-T, as is evident by his past roles in New Jack City, Ricochet, and Trespass. The veteran gangster rapper takes yet another such role in Luck Of The Draw, an upcoming movie co-starring Dennis Hopper. Meanwhile, the Iceman will make an appearance on the small screen on FX's The X Show tonight at 11 p.m. (PDT and EDT).

In the forthcoming film, Ice plays a character named McNealy who teams with Hopper's character in a scam to produce counterfeit money. Critics have condemned Ice for continuing to take so-called negative roles, but Ice isn't complaining.

The key to landing movie roles is creating a character, says Ice. "People will come back and tell you, 'Oh, you're being typecasted' and this and that," Ice told LAUNCH on the Palos Verdes, Calif. set of the movie, "but you worry about that after 100 movies. You don't worry about that when you're just coming through the gate."

Ice says his reputation as a "heavy" has awarded him a half a dozen film roles this year alone. He doesn't see himself as the next Will Smith, but he would love to play a villain in a major feature film, such as Independence Day or Wild Wild West.

"The only way I see myself in a role or film of that size is if say [Sylvester] Stallone or somebody needs an enemy, the same way Wesley [Snipes] got put on in Demolition Man...I think you could see me going up against [Arnold] Schwarzenegger."

Ice T's seventh album, 7th Deadly Sin, is scheduled to be released on Sept. 14 on Atomic Pop--and select e-commerce sites--as a digital download and CD. It will hit traditional retail on Oct. 12.
